#4002dd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4002dd is composed of 25.1% red, 0.8%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71% cyan, 99.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 257 degrees, a saturation of 98.2% and a lightness of 43.7%. #4002dd color hex could be obtained by blending #8004ff with #0000bb.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

Shades and Tints of #4002dd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020007 is the darkest color, while #f6f3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4002dd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d6976 is the less saturated color, while #4002dd is the most saturated one.
